Output b105389d66f2bb26e762adfc7ad781b014cac09b0883e66cb8d21a1ff542c546:1

value
482508
script pubkey
OP_0 OP_PUSHBYTES_20 43c0fecbfa058e60f0321b9ba1341dfa63e39b78
address
tb1qg0q0ajl6qk8xpupjrwd6zdqalf378xmclnnuk6
transaction
b105389d66f2bb26e762adfc7ad781b014cac09b0883e66cb8d21a1ff542c546
confirmations
102196
spent
true